John 15:5: I am the vine; you are the branches. If a man remains in me and I in him, he will bear much fruit; apart from me you can do nothing.
Lately I have been having power connection problems with my laptop. At first I thought the problem was with the cord, but now I know it’s the actual connector that is the culprit.
Yesterday the power supply worked fine and actually charged up my battery. Then it stopped working. The battery was full for a while, but eventually lost power too. Today it will not even power on!
This week, as I’ve struggled with my laptop, the Lord has reminded me that I also need to remain connected to him. It’s not enough to just fill my battery and then run on my own strength. I need to stay connected to the real source of power – God himself.
It’s a simple analogy, but at this busy time of year, one I really need to be reminded of. I hope you too are taking time to be connected to the Lord so you can be more fruitful in your life.
